Last Wednesday (7/26/16) @Brandon Turner hosted his weekly webinar and the topic was about Rental Property Investing. He named five "Rights" during the webinar and identified one of the rights as having "The Right Hustle." He asked those of us listening to think about our "why." Why do we want to invest in real estate?

So I pose the question to the BP community. What is your why? Has your why changed over time? Do you have multiple?

My why(s):

  • The prototypical financial freedom we all seek. But it is more about what the freedom offers me: A life that has the ability to be full of time for the things I care about. Those things are my loved ones, adventure,  and experience.
  • As a lifelong athlete, I love and thrive in a competitive environment. I find the field of real estate to be just as competitive as any sport I have taken part in. The competition drives and excites me.

I look forward to hearing about your WHY!
